Compliance also requires an understanding of MIL-STD-2073 preservation levels. Level A protection is designed for the most severe worldwide shipment and storage conditions, while Commercial levels are typically reserved for domestic transit with lower risk profiles. Choosing the wrong level can lead to either a rejected shipment or unnecessary material costs. Weather-Resistant Corrugated: V3C vs. W5C
Military-grade corrugated boxes are engineered for performance that exceeds standard industrial boxes. V3C is a high-performance, water-resistant material used for overseas military deployment. While standard boxes lose structural integrity when wet, V3C and W5C materials maintain their burst strength in high-humidity environments. For heavier payloads, we often specify heavy-duty double-wall or triple-wall boxes. These materials provide the stacking strength required for military logistics chains where pallets might be stored in uncontrolled environments for extended periods.

Verifying Contractual Compliance
Government contracts utilize a complex system of packaging codes known as Methods of Preservation. These codes dictate the exact cleaning, drying, and wrapping procedures required for each part. When you communicate these technical requirements to your packaging manufacturer, provide the full preservation string to ensure no details are lost. MIL-STD-2073 outlines the standard process for military packaging development. This standard provides the framework for protecting items against the hazards of the military distribution system, ensuring your hardware arrives in mission-ready condition.
Selecting the Right Pallet and Crate System
The choice between custom wood crates and heavy-duty corrugated containers depends on the weight and fragility of your payload. While crates offer full enclosure for machinery, many components are best served by heavy-duty RSC boxes (Regular Slotted Cartons) engineered for high burst strength. To prevent strap damage and improve stacking stability on palletized loads, we integrate corner boards. These edge protectors allow for higher tension strapping without crushing the corrugated walls. What are V3C and W5C corrugated boxes, and when should I use them?
V3C and W5C are weather-resistant corrugated materials designed for high-humidity and overseas transit. V3C is a high-performance material with superior burst strength, while W5C offers a lighter-weight alternative that still maintains moisture resistance. You should use these materials when your contract specifies Level A protection or when shipments face uncontrolled environmental conditions. They’re essential for protecting sensitive hardware from structural failure caused by water absorption or extreme humidity.
How do I ensure my wood crates are compliant for international military export?
Compliance for international military export requires all wood packaging to meet ISPM-15 standards for heat treatment. PFI provides custom wood crates and pallets that are heat-treated and stamped to prove they are pest-free. This certification is mandatory for crossing international borders and prevents your shipments from being quarantined or rejected by customs.
